A revolutionary technology that disrupts the insurance industry will take centre stage in New Zealand as part of a three-day conference.

The Blockchain NZ 2017, organised by BlockchainLabs NZ and Blockchain Association of New Zealand, will be held from May 08 to 10 in Auckland.

The event, which will run as part of New Zealand Techweek, aims to empower organisations to collaborate, undertake R&D, and commercialise new disruptive blockchain business models.

It features a series of presentations, panel discussions, workshops and networking events, designed to teach about the basics of blockchain and explore some of the ways by which the technology can be used to disrupt business models.

Top speakers from around the world will take part in the event, including Vitalik Buterin, creator of Ethereum; and Andreas M. Antonopoulos, author of “Mastering Bitcoin” and “The Internet of Money.

The conference will be divided into the following themes: An Introduction for Beginners, Money and Finance, New Funding and Organisational Models, Owning Our Data, Changing Business Models, and The Future and Changing the World.
